Bug 1994606 - Details missing on the card while installing ODF Operator via UI
Summary: Details missing on the card while installing ODF Operator via UI
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at OpenShift Data Foundation
Classification: Red Hat Storage
Component: odf-operator
Version: 4.9
Hardware: Unspecified
OS: Unspecified
unspecified
high
Target Milestone: ---
: ODF 4.9.0
Assignee: Nitin Goyal
QA Contact: Aman Agrawal
URL:
Whiteboard:
: 2000533 2018199 (view as bug list)
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2021-08-17 14:13 UTC by Aman Agrawal
Modified: 2023-08-09 17:00 UTC (History)
13 users (show)

Fixed In Version: v4.9.0-139.ci
Doc Type: No Doc Update
Doc Text:
Clone Of:
Environment:
Last Closed: 2021-12-13 17:44:58 UTC
Embargoed:


Attachments (Terms of Use)
ODF Operator Card (43.67 KB, image/png)
2021-08-17 14:13 UTC, Aman Agrawal
no flags Details


Links
System ID Private Priority Status Summary Last Updated
Github red-hat-storage odf-operator pull 150 0 None open Bug 1994606: [release-4.9] bundle: update card description for UI 2021-11-15 16:55:28 UTC
Github red-hat-storage odf-operator pull 84 0 None None None 2021-09-09 09:43:28 UTC
Github red-hat-storage odf-operator pull 85 0 None None None 2021-09-09 14:27:49 UTC
Red Hat Product Errata RHSA-2021:5086 0 None None None 2021-12-13 17:45:57 UTC

Description Aman Agrawal 2021-08-17 14:13:16 UTC
Created attachment 1814828 [details]
ODF Operator Card

Description of problem:


Version-Release number of selected component (if applicable):


How reproducible:


Steps to Reproduce:
1.Go to 'OperatorHub' and search for OpenShift Data Foundation
2.Click on the card as we do for installation.
3. Notice that the details for repository, container image, support etc. are set to N/A and are missing.

Actual results: Details for repository, container image, support etc. are set to N/A on the card while installing ODF Operator.


Expected results: Add all the relevant details.


Additional info:

Comment 6 Nitin Goyal 2021-09-09 16:28:08 UTC
*** Bug 2000533 has been marked as a duplicate of this bug. ***

Comment 10 Jose A. Rivera 2021-09-17 11:59:59 UTC
Nitin has it right, you are only linking to mock-ups, none of this information was ever actually in the bundle itself. We need PRs (and BZs) to update the CSV description if anything is missing. My guess would be we'd need to copy over most of the ocs-operator description, since ocs-operator is no longer visible in the UI, but we don't have any solid requirements at this time.

Comment 15 Mugdha Soni 2021-09-30 11:55:33 UTC
Hi 

Tested with ODF version "4.9.0-158.ci" and OCP 4.9.

The detail card has all the information related to repo, version, source ,provider but i need guidance with the description that is around "OpenShift Data Foundation operator" ,OpenShift Data Foundation console and "Core Capabilities". 

Do we need to add anything more in the detail card or these description?

4.9 ODF operator detail card is attached in comment#14

Comment 17 Mugdha Soni 2021-10-04 08:28:56 UTC
Hi Yuval 

Request you for clarification on the comment#15 and comment#16 .


Thanks 
Mugdha

Comment 18 Yuval 2021-11-09 12:57:31 UTC
so I'm very sorry for the very late response, so after discussing this topic with Eran he said that he wants to keep the same text we had for OCS and just change OCS to ODF in all places. 
see the design: https://marvelapp.com/prototype/g1h86ga/screen/78847977

Comment 21 Eran Tamir 2021-11-10 10:44:30 UTC
@

Comment 24 Aman Agrawal 2021-11-10 15:48:32 UTC
*** Bug 2018199 has been marked as a duplicate of this bug. ***

Comment 26 Mugdha Soni 2021-11-15 12:53:10 UTC
Hi Eran and Aman

Following steps were performed :-

1. Created an OCP 4.9 cluster via jenkins .
2. Created a catalogsoure.yaml with the latest ODF version 


##[root@localhost doc]# cat catalogsource.yaml 
apiVersion: operators.coreos.com/v1alpha1
kind: CatalogSource
metadata:
  labels:
    ocs-operator-internal: 'true'
  name: redhat-operators
  namespace: openshift-marketplace
spec:
  displayName: Openshift Data Foundation
  icon:
    base64data: ''
    mediatype: ''
  image: quay.io/rhceph-dev/ocs-registry:4.9.0-237.ci
  priority: 100
  publisher: Red Hat
  sourceType: grpc
  updateStrategy:
    registryPoll:
      interval: 15m

3. Logged into the console and directedtowards operator hub.

** Information was missing as compared to https://marvelapp.com/prototype/g1h86ga/screen/78847977(screenshot for the same is attached in comment #24)

Please guide me here !

Thanks 
Mugdha

Comment 32 Jose A. Rivera 2021-11-17 17:25:42 UTC
I can jump in in this one: I chatted with Eran over DM and the current stopgap is to ship with what was in the PR as-is. This is immensely low priority and not worth holding up the release. I'm going to move the bug back to ON_QA, we'll do a more thorough rewrite in 4.9.z.

Comment 36 errata-xmlrpc 2021-12-13 17:44:58 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Moderate: Red Hat OpenShift Data Foundation 4.9.0 enhancement, security, and bug fix update),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2021:5086


Note You need to log in before you can comment on or make changes to this bug.